BANKING LOBBYIST DEFENDS NAMA - Pat Farrell, chief executive of the Irish Banking Federation, welcomed the impending publication of the draft National Asset Management Association legislation, and said that it is a critical step in returning the banking system to health.

He said he believes that banks will co-operate with the project to help make it a success.

He adds that it is his understanding that banks will adopt a supportive attitude to smaller developers who fall outside NAMA's remit.
